Invitation to a Charity Concert for the Children of the Refugees from Nazi Germany, Signed by Eddie Cantor, London, 1940
Invitation to a charity concert for the welfare of children of refugees fleeing Nazi Germany, signed by Eddie Cantor on the binding.
 
Eddie Cantor 1892-1964 was a Jewish-American singer, comic, dancer, actor and songwriter. He was known to audiences from Broadway, radio and television in its early days as "Banjo Eyes."
 
Cantor was born Edward Israel Itzkowitz in New York, USA, to immigrants from Russia. He started working with Hadassah, then a small Zionist organization, in the 1930s to build support for Jews fleeing Europe to Palestine. Cantor made several major speeches condemning anti-Semitism and spoke out about the dangers of fascism and Nazism before the United States’ entered WWII in 1941.

29 cm.

Fine condition, stains.
